On average across the year,
yes, San Marino is hotter than
Oak Lawn, Illinois
.
San Marino has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F and Oak Lawn, Illinois has an average temperature of 11°C/52°F.
San Marino's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Oak Lawn, Illinois's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, San Marino is not colder than Oak Lawn, Illinois . San Marino has an average minimum temperature of 9°C/48°F and Oak Lawn, Illinois has an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F.
On average across the year,
no, San Marino has less rain than
Oak Lawn, Illinois. San Marino has an average annual rainfall of 514mm and Oak Lawn, Illinois has an average annual rainfall of 1222mm.
San Marino's wettest month is February, with an average monthly rainfall of 65mm, which is drier than Oak Lawn, Illinois's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 162mm).
